Output 23458395195fdd1e59336071e091d921c1f2e570f89e1057be1a03b49083652a:21

value
29755362
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 759807b12f890796472180d3bc06df8b78c3c366 OP_EQUALVERIFY OP_CHECKSIG
address
1BinBgGZAFTsJktebBwpQqVeVSGK8pY4Es
transaction
23458395195fdd1e59336071e091d921c1f2e570f89e1057be1a03b49083652a